package org.apache.pivot.util.test;
import static org.junit.Assert.*;
import java.util.HashSet;
import java.util.Iterator;
import org.apache.pivot.util.ObservableSetAdapter;
import org.junit.Test;
public class ObservableSetAdapterTest {
@Test
public void basicTest() {
ObservableSetAdapter<String> set = new ObservableSetAdapter<String>(new HashSet<String>());
set.add("A");
assertTrue(set.contains("A"));
set.add("B");
assertTrue(set.contains("A"));
assertTrue(set.contains("B"));
assertEquals(set.size(), 2);
int i = 0;
for (String element : set) {
assertTrue(element.equals("A")
|| element.equals("B"));
i++;
}
assertEquals(i, 2);
set.remove("B");
assertFalse(set.contains("B"));
set.remove("A");
assertFalse(set.contains("A"));
assertTrue(set.isEmpty());
set.add("A");
set.add("B");
set.add("C");
Iterator<String> iter = set.iterator();
int count = 0;
while (iter.hasNext()) {
String s = iter.next();
if (!set.contains(s)) {
fail("Unknown element in set " + s);
}
count++;
}
assertEquals(3, count);
iter = set.iterator();
while (iter.hasNext()) {
iter.next();
iter.remove();
}
assertEquals(0, set.size());
}
@Test
public void equalsTest() {
ObservableSetAdapter<String> set1 = new ObservableSetAdapter<String>(new HashSet<String>());
set1.add("one");
set1.add("two");
set1.add("three");
ObservableSetAdapter<String> set2 = new ObservableSetAdapter<String>(new HashSet<String>());
set2.add("one");
set2.add("two");
set2.add("three");
// Same
assertTrue(set1.equals(set2));
// Different values
set2.remove("three");
set2.add("four");
assertFalse(set1.equals(set2));
// Different lengths
set2.add("three");
assertFalse(set1.equals(set2));
}
}
